Job Description
Customer Support Specialist
Gamdom
• Deliver prompt and effective assistance to our customers. • Queries can vary from informing clients about available deposit methods, guiding customers through current offers, advising on bet settlements, explaining internal rules, and more. • Resolve technical issues and guide clients through problem-solving processes, with a focus on customer satisfaction and first-contact resolution. • Leverage your passion for iGaming and eSports, even if you're new to the field, to provide informed and helpful assistance to clients. • Work closely with a diverse team in a remote environment to ensure seamless communication and coordination, contributing to a positive team culture. • Demonstrate the ability to work independently and make informed decisions to address client needs and concerns.
Job Requirements
- Previous customer service experience (iGaming experience is a plus)
- Tech-savvy, with a passion for customer service and the ability to quickly adapt to new tools and software
- Experience in cryptocurrency is an advantage
- Strong written and verbal communication skills in English (fluency in Turkish, French, Spanish, or Japanese is an additional plus)
- Ability to collaborate effectively with a remote team, fostering a positive and supportive work environment
- Capable of working autonomously and making sound decisions to address customer needs
- Flexibility: Willingness to learn and work varying shifts in a 24/7 support team
Benefits
- 25 days of PTO
- Equipment allowance
- Flexible remote work
